1. 确保TIA Portal已安装SCL编程包 2. 在程序块中创建新的SCL程序块: 右键程序块 -> 添加新块 -> 选择'FB'或'FC' -> 编程语言选择'SCL' 优化编程体验的关键设置: · 启用代码自动补全功能 · 配置代码折叠选项 · 设置适合的字体和配色方案
DT_Date and DT_TOD apply in TIA Portal 因为软件架构的问题,需要将OB1中的变量OB1_DATE_TIME,变量类型Date_And_Time转换成程序中可以使用的日期还有时间。 但在导入到博图中之后显示错误,如下所示: 因此需要在博图中寻找相应的功能块来实现相同的功能。 主要的作用就是将Date_And_Time 中的信息提出其中的日...
在转换为 TIME 数据类型之前必须将所有数据类型(INT,REAL,BCD 等)转换为DINT。“T_CONV ” 指令在块编辑器的“扩展指令 > 日期和时间” 指令卡中。 图3 给出了一个将 INT 和 REAL 转换为 TIME 格式的例子。 图. 3 硬件数据类型 HW_IO 的转换 硬件数据类型 HW_IO 是 STEP 7 (TIA Portal) 访问模板...
在STEP 7(TIA Portal)中,可以使用“指令”选项板中的转换功能将变量的内容转换为的所选数据类型。转换数据类型INT,DINT,REAL和BCD编号 STEP 7(TIA Portal)提供 “CONV”(转换)以转换数据类型INT,DINT,REAL和BCD编号。按照以下说明在块编辑器中插入和参数化此操作。在...
seconds 输出 Int 秒数 0, ..., 59 该库可以用于S7-1200/S7-1500,也可用于S7-300。主模板文件夹包含两个子文件夹。每个子文件夹均包含FB "MillisecToTime" 及其背景DB,全局 DB "MsToTime" 和 OB "ChangeTime"。 使用S7-1200 或者 S7-1500 时,需要从 "S7-1200/S7-1500" 子文件夹中拖拽各块至程序...
将 ZIP 文件解压到一个单独的目录下。然后使用 STEP 7 (TIA Portal) 软件打开和编辑这个库。 库的注意事项必须使用 STEP 7 (TIA Portal) 软件打开编辑该库。 注意STEP 7 (TIA Portal) 软件中的 "FRAC" 指令 (提取小数) 能够确定输入值的小数位。寻找该指令的路径"基本指令> 数学函数"。
网络2调用 "RD_SYS_T" 读取 CPU 时钟的日期和时间。 调用"T_CONV" 指令从 “DT” 格式中提取数据类型 “Date”, “Int” 和“TOD”。 在OB 块 "ReadWriteOB" 中调用 "ReadWriteTime" 功能,并将 DB 块 "TimeDB" 中的变量填写到该功能的管脚上。图...
Currently, TIA Portal software has many versions such as TIA Portal V14, TIA Portal V15, TIA Portal V16, TIA Portal V17 and the latest is TIA Portal V18. Depending on the needs of use, users will choose to install the corresponding version of TIA portal. Today plc247.com would like to...
1.创建功能块创建功能块:在TIAPortal中,选择“创建”-“功能块”,定义功能块的名称和接口。 2.编程编程:使用LAD、FBD或STL等编程语言,编写功能块的内部逻辑。 3.参数设置参数设置:定义功能块的输入和输出参数,以及任何需要的静态或动态变量。 4.测试与调试测试与调试:在仿真环境中测试功能块,确保其逻辑正确无误...
WinCC (TIA Portal) Runtime 支持 XML文件格式,可以通过Visual Basic Visual Basic scripts访问“XML DOM”对象。 以下FAQ 将通过3个例子介绍,如何通过WinCC RT 的变量管理器使用VBS将变量“Material”,“Pressure” “Temperature” 归档成XML文件及读取归档值。示例项目提供了下载链接,其中包含了脚本配置和演示了它们...